ResumoThe coloured sulfhydryl reagent, N-(4-dimethylamino-3,5-dinitrophenyl) maleimide (DDPM), has been synthesized and its reactions with cysteine and with the free SH groups of human and bovine serum albumin have been studied. The DDPS-serum albumins, prepared from DDPM and serum albumins, were subjected to hydrolysis with pepsin. From the digests, S-DDPS-cysteine peptides were isolated by means of their yellow colour, and purified by adsorption on talc, paper ionophoresis and chromatography. The same amino acid sequence, Leu-Glu(NH2)-Asp-Glu-Glu-(NH2)-Glu-CySH-Pro-Phe, have been found to occur in the peptides derived from bovine and from human serum albumin.
